Exodus 40:23
40:22 And he put the table in the tent of the congregation, upon the side of the tabernacle northward, without the vail.And he set the bread in order upon it before the LORD; as the LORD had commanded Moses.
KJV
He set the bread in order on it before Yahweh, as Yahweh commanded Moses.
And he set the bread in order upon it before the Lord; as the Lord had commanded Moses.
And he set the bread in order on it before the LORD; as the LORD had commanded Moses. ¶

Cross-references
Related passages from the Treasury of Scripture Knowledge.
And thou shalt set upon the table shewbread before me alway.
Exodus 40:4And thou shalt bring in the table, and set in order the things that are to be set in order upon it; and thou shalt bring in the candlestick, and light the lamps thereof. the things: Heb. the order thereof
Matthew 12:4How he entered into the house of God, and did eat the shewbread, which was not lawful for him to eat, neither for them which were with him, but only for the priests?
Hebrews 9:2For there was a tabernacle made; the first, wherein was the candlestick, and the table, and the shewbread; which is called the sanctuary. the sanctuary: or, holy
